I Worship You came out of a really heavy season in my life. I was dealing with pressure, emotional strain, and spiritual wrestling, the kind of internal battles that make you either run from God or collapse at His feet. This song became my choice to fall down in worship.
It’s a declaration that no matter the season, trial, storm, victory, or the quiet moments in between….
God is worthy of worship.
This track captures the heart of what Worshipcore means to me: worship in spirit, worship in truth, worship through fire.

đź“– Scripture Inspiration
This song is built directly from two foundational passages on worship (among others).
John 4:23 (NASB)
“But an hour is coming, and is now here, when the true worshipers will worship the Father in spirit and truth; for such people the Father seeks to be His worshipers.”
Romans 12:1 (NASB)
“Therefore I urge you, brothers and sisters, by the mercies of God, to present your bodies as a living and holy sacrifice, acceptable to God, which is your spiritual service of worship.”
These verses hit me deeply during the time I wrote this. They reminded me that worship isn’t a song — it’s a life. It’s surrender. It’s sacrifice. It’s devotion. It’s choosing God in the midst of pain and pressure.

⚔️ Worshipcore Sound & Production Notes
When I created this song, I wanted it to feel like worship breaking through the middle of a storm.
- The intro feels like heaven opening before everything crashes in.
- Verse 1 sets the tone of intentional worship in every breath.
- The screams emphasize the intensity of real devotion.
- The chorus is pure worship: lifted, soaring, and unashamed.
- Verse 2 contrasts the fading world with the eternal glory of God.
- The bridge is a thunderous declaration of Christ’s supremacy.
- The final chorus is designed to feel like surrender and celebration at the same time.
This is one of the songs where the sound, message, and Scripture all came together naturally with the perfect mix of heaviness and worship.
